Classification
- GCOMMERCIO ALL'INGROSSO E AL DETTAGLIO
- 46Commercio all'ingrosso
- 46.1Attività di servizi di intermediazione per il commercio all'ingrosso
- 46.18Attività di intermediari del commercio all'ingrosso di altri prodotti specifici
- 46.18.4Attività di intermediari del commercio all'ingrosso di automobili, altri autoveicoli e motocicli
- 46.18.46Attività di intermediari del commercio all'ingrosso di materiale rotabile e di parti e accessori per materiale rotabile
Description
- activities of agents involved in the wholesale of rolling stock
- activities of agents involved in the wholesale of parts and accessories for rolling stock
Exclusion notes
Excluded from division 46:
- trade of electricity, see 35.15
- trade of gaseous fuels for energy supply through mains, see 35.23
- rental and leasing of goods, see division 77
- packaging of solid goods and bottling of liquid or gaseous goods, including blending and filtering for third parties, see 82.92
Excluded from group 46.1:
- wholesale on own account, see 46.2, 46.3, 46.4, 46.5, 46.6, 46.7, 46.8, 46.9
- activities of commission agents who assume ownership of the goods, even if they are acting in the name of a third party, see 46.2, 46.3, 46.4, 46.5, 46.6, 46.7, 46.8, 46.9
- intermediation service activities for retail sale, see 47.9
- intermediation service activities for real estate activities, see 68.31
- operation of websites providing searches for goods that link the customers to sellers, see the corresponding classes for intermediation service activities
- activities of advertising, market research and public relations, see division 73
Excluded from class 46.18:
- wholesale on own account, see 46.2, 46.3, 46.4, 46.5, 46.6, 46.7, 46.8, 46.9
- activities of commission agents who assume ownership of the goods, even if they are acting in the name of a third party, see 46.2, 46.3, 46.4, 46.5, 46.6, 46.7, 46.8, 46.9
- waste trade activities as wholesalers, see 46.87
- activities of insurance agents, see 66.22
- activities of real estate agents, see 68.31
- activities of sale representatives, for promotion purposes, see 73.30
Frequently asked questions
I act as an agent for railway wagons and locomotives — this code or the one for other motor vehicles?
Yes, rolling stock (wagons, coaches, locomotives) and related spare parts sold on a commission basis fall under 46.18.46. The distinction is track versus road: road vehicles such as trucks and camping vehicles go in 46.18.42.
I handle both railway coaches and their spare parts — do I need two codes?
No, in this case one is enough. Rolling stock and its parts and accessories are listed together within the same code 46.18.46, so both activities belong here. The key requirement is that you act as an intermediary on a commission basis, without taking ownership of the vehicles.
Agent for rolling stock versus a company that buys and resells rolling stock — which code applies?
As a commission agent who never takes charge of the rolling stock, you stay in 46.18.46. If the company instead purchases and resells the rolling stock or spare parts on its own account, the activity is direct wholesale trade and requires a different code outside this agents' family.
